Sharon and Tim Lemkau have been very active in the Webster County 4-H program as they started a co-ed club for their own children to be involved with; had club meetings in their home the last ten years; worked with the aerospace and rabbit projects by providing leadership, fair support, and working with the youth as they learned in these areas.  They promoted the aerospace program during the Iowa State Fair for a few years; chaperoned the 2004 Citizenship Washington Focus trip, chaperoned 4-H conference, and chaperoned many 4-H dances.  They supported their children in the 4-H program and saw the benefits that come with being actively involved in 4-H.  They also encouraged all 4-H’ers to be their best.  

As their children finished 4-H, the announcement came that they were going to slow down from their 4-H activities.  Just as they started to do this, Sharon was diagnosed with bone cancer and died in February 2006.  Sharon and Tim were presented this award in February, the night before Sharon died.  No one can ever replace her love of the 4-H program or 4-H kids.  Memorial money will support a 4-H scholarship in her name for the next fifteen years.
